Subject: Sproutly scheduler — new owner

Hi on-call folks,

Quick heads-up: I'm rotating off the Sproutly plant-watering scheduler at the end of the sprint. Pager routing is already updated, runbooks are in the usual wiki spot. The moisture-sensor retry bug is still open — context is in the ticket. Going forward, escalations for the scheduler should go to:

account owner for kafop-haweg: Pelax Gilael Istir

Step 3 of the GraphTrellis migration. Once you've pointed the visualizer at the new edge store, old snapshots won't render — that's expected, don't panic. Heads up for Thursday's sync: the layout worker now reads its settings from the shared manifest instead of env vars, so Renata's old cheat sheet is obsolete. The settings you actually need are these.

deployment values, tafof-taduf:
pelius:
  pin: 6508
  tenant: praiel
  seal: seal_4e33a2f4
  metrics_host: metrics.pelius.plorvagrid.corp
  standby_team: druix
  escalation: juldor-norius
  nonce: 5db598

Key Ceremony Checklist — Item 7 (PodLint Validator)

Confirm both keyholders are present and the PodLint signing module shows state SEALED. Rotate the feed-validator signing key per the ceremony script, then verify a test podcast feed validates cleanly against the new key. Record the rotation timestamp in the ceremony log. Before sealing the module again, confirm the recovery passphrase shown below matches the one in the printed envelope.

unlock words, hahip-yagef: zorok-novmir-zorix-silax

## Deploying the Gatewick Proctor Queue

Deploys are pretty painless: push to main, wait for the pipeline, then watch the queue drain dashboard for five minutes. If candidates pile up mid-exam, roll back first and ask questions later — the queue replays safely. Everything the workers care about lives in one config block, shown here for reference.

settings of bafof-yagef:
JOROX_PIN=8740
JOROX_TENANT=pelox
JOROX_METRICS_HOST=metrics.jorox.qorvelworks.internal
JOROX_SEAL=seal_c78f63c1
JOROX_STANDBY_TEAM=norax

Hey — handing off Pellmoor on-call. The Frostline handlers are cold-starting slow again after last night's deploy; pre-warmer cron is flaky, so just restart it if latency spikes. If the warmer config store locks you out, unseal it with the recovery passphrase below.

vault phrase of hawif-bahof = novvan-belius-istael-fenvan-holdor-druox-eliath